Delete .................................. Single-file, all files (with protection)

Effective Pixels .................. 7.2 million

Imaging Element ................ 1/1.8-inch square pixel color CCD

(Total pixels: 7.41 million)

Lens/Focal Distance ......... Eight lenses in seven groups, including

an aspherical lens
F2.8 (W) to 4 (T); f=7.1 (W) to 28.4mm
(T) (equivalent to approximately 33
(W) to 132 (T) for 35mm film)

Zoom ................................... 4X optical zoom; 4X digital zoom

(16X in combination with optical zoom)

Focusing ............................. Combination phase differential sensor

and contrast Auto Focus (AF) mode
(AF Area: Spot, Multi, or Free); Macro
mode; Infinity mode; Manual Focus;
focus lock

Approximate Focus Range (from lens surface)

Normal ............................. 40cm to

∞ (1.3´ to ∞)

Macro .............................. Approximately 10cm to 50cm

(3.9˝ to 19.7˝) at wide angle
Approximately 40cm to 50cm
(15.6˝ to 19.7˝) at telephoto

Exposure Control

Light Metering ................. Multi-pattern by CCD
Exposure ......................... Program AE, Aperture priority AE,

Shutter speed priority AE, Manual
exposure

Exposure Compensation ..... –2EV to +2EV (1/3EV units)

Shutter ................................ CCD electronic shutter; mechanical

shutter,
Snapshot mode, BESTSHOT mode :
1/8 to 1/2000 second
Aperture Priority AE mode : 1 to
1/2000 second
Shutter Speed Priority AE mode,
Manual Exposure mode : BULB, 60 to
1/2000 second
• Shutter speed is different for the

following BESTSHOT scenes.
Night Scene: 4 to 1/2000 second
Fireworks: BULB, 60 to 1/2000
second

Aperture .............................. F2.8, 3.2, 3.5, 4.0, 4.5, 5.0, 5.6, 6.3,

7.1, 8.0
• Using optical zoom causes the

aperture to change.

• An aperture setting from F2.8 to 5.6

is possible in the Snapshot mode
